The primary driver fueling the ICS security solutions market is the escalating frequency and sophistication of cyberattacks targeting industrial control environments. Critical infrastructure sectors such as energy, water, and manufacturing are increasingly targeted by nation-state actors and cybercriminal groups, emphasizing the need for robust security measures. Regulatory mandates, including NERC CIP and IEC 62443 standards, compel organizations to adopt advanced security protocols, further accelerating market adoption. Additionally, the rising integration of IoT and IIoT devices within industrial networks expands the attack surface, necessitating comprehensive security solutions. The convergence of operational technology and information technology environments creates complex security challenges, prompting organizations to invest heavily in specialized ICS security solutions that can detect, prevent, and respond to threats in real time. This strategic shift towards proactive cybersecurity measures is shaping the long-term growth trajectory of the market, making ICS security a critical component of industrial resilience strategies worldwide.

Implementing ICS security solutions often involves significant operational challenges, including high deployment costs and complex integration with existing legacy systems. Many industrial facilities operate on outdated infrastructure that lacks compatibility with modern security tools, necessitating costly upgrades and extensive customization. Regulatory compliance adds another layer of complexity, as organizations must navigate a patchwork of standards across different regions, increasing administrative burdens and potential legal risks. Supply chain risks also pose a threat, with shortages of specialized components or software delays impacting deployment timelines. Infrastructure limitations, especially in developing regions, hinder the widespread adoption of advanced security measures. These operational and regulatory hurdles collectively slow down market penetration and require strategic planning and substantial investment to overcome.
